(1R,4S)-4-((tert-Butoxycarbonyl)amino)cyclopent-2-enecarboxylic acid is primarily used in organic synthesis and pharmaceutical research. It serves as a key intermediate in the preparation of more complex molecules, particularly in the development of drugs and bioactive compounds. The tert-butoxycarbonyl (Boc) protecting group in the molecule is crucial for safeguarding the amino functionality during multi-step synthetic processes, allowing for selective reactions to occur elsewhere in the molecule. This compound is often employed in the synthesis of peptidomimetics and other small molecules that mimic peptide structures, which are valuable in drug discovery for targeting various diseases. Additionally, its cyclopentene ring structure makes it a useful building block for creating constrained analogs of biologically active compounds, enhancing their stability and potency.
